<div class="warning"> 이 글은 "웹 개발 2.0 루비 온 레일스" 를 공부하면서 개인적으로 정리한 내용입니다. 상세한 내용을 보고자 하시는 분은 책을 구매하시길 바랍니다. </div>

데이터 베이스#

  • 데이터베이스 생성

create database if not exists phonebook default charset utf8;

  • 테이블 생성

drop table if exists people;

create table people (
  id int auto_increment primary key,
  group_id int,
  name varchar(20),
  phone_number varchar(20),
  note text
);

  • 테이블 생성(그룹)

drop table if exists groups;

create table groups (
  id int auto_increment primary key,
  name varchar(20)
);

여기서 people의 group_id는 groups의 id값을 참조하는 일종의 외래키 참조라고 보면 된다.

Add new attachment

Only authorized users are allowed to upload new attachments.
« This page (revision-7) was last changed on 17-Jul-2007 17:27 by DongGukLee